    I'm not sure if this is what you're looking for, but back back in the day, when WoW was still new, I decided to try playing a priest. We wnet int Wailing Caverns (I think), and I really got into trying to keep the party alive, while avoiding being killed. At the time, if I remember, healing caused you to have pretty high threat.

    I enjoyed it much more than I would have thought. I've been playing healing classes since.
